In today’s fast-paced world, achieving a healthy work-life balance can be challenging. Juggling professional responsibilities with personal interests often feels like a delicate dance.
Finding that perfect equilibrium requires intentional strategies and self-awareness. Here’s how you can strike a balance between work and personal life:

  1. Define Your Priorities
  • Identify Your Goals: Reflect on your professional and personal goals. What do you want to achieve in your career? What are your personal aspirations and values?
  • Set Priorities: Prioritize activities and tasks that align with your goals. This helps you focus your time and energy on what’s most important, both at work and in your personal life.

2. Create a Structured Schedule

  • Plan Your Day: Start by creating a daily or weekly plan.
  • Block Time: Allocate specific blocks of time for work, family, exercise, relaxation or simply to visit a Jewellery Exhibition in Mumbai.

3. Set Clear Boundaries

  • Designate Work Hours: Set specific work hours and stick to them. Avoid working beyond these hours to prevent burnout and ensure you have time for personal activities.
  • Create a Work-Free Zone: If possible, establish a dedicated workspace at home. Keep this area separate from your personal spaces to help maintain a clear boundary between work and home life.

4. Learn to Say No

  • Assess Your Capacity: Before taking on new tasks or responsibilities, evaluate how they will impact your existing commitments.
  • Practice Assertiveness: Politely decline additional work or social invitations if they conflict with your priorities or overwhelm your schedule.

5. Make Time for Self-Care

  • Incorporate Relaxation: Schedule regular time for activities that help you unwind, such as reading, meditating, visiting a Jewellery Exhibition in Mumbai or taking a walk.
  • Prioritize Health: Engage in regular physical activity, eat a balanced diet, and ensure you get adequate sleep

6. Delegate and Collaborate

  • Delegate Tasks: At work, delegate tasks when possible to avoid becoming overwhelmed. Similarly, share household responsibilities with family members to reduce your burden.
  • Collaborate with Others: Collaborate with colleagues and family members to achieve common goals and support each other’s needs.

Achieving a good work-life balance involves careful planning, clear boundaries, and regular self-care. With these strategies, you’ll be well-equipped to achieve and sustain a fulfilling work-life balance.
